Advantages of PERT Pipe
 

Flexibility: PERT pipes are highly flexible and offer a range of installation options. They can be bent and curved to fit the contours of any space, making them ideal for complex installations with tight corners and limited access.

 

Corrosion resistance: PERT pipes are highly resistant to corrosion and rust, which makes them ideal for use in areas with high moisture levels. They do not deteriorate over time, helping to prolong the lifespan of the entire piping system.

 

Thermal resistance: PERT pipes are designed to withstand high temperature fluctuations without cracking or deforming. They can handle both hot and cold water temperatures, making them perfect for use in a wide range of domestic and commercial applications.

 

Low installation costs: PERT pipes are relatively easy to install, which reduces the overall installation costs. Their flexibility allows for speedy installation, reducing the downtime in projects.

 

Easy to maintain: PERT pipes require little maintenance over their lifespan. Unlike traditional copper pipes, they do not corrode and do not require regular pipe replacements.

 

Energy efficiency: PERT pipes are highly energy-efficient, thanks to their superior insulation properties. They help to reduce heat loss, which can translate into lower energy consumption in homes and buildings.

 

Safe for drinking water: PERT pipes are approved for use in potable water supply systems. They do not contaminate water with harmful substances and are safe for drinking.

Application of PERT Pipe

 

 

Floor heating system

PERT pipe is used to transport hot water in floor heating system, which is safe, reliable, energy-saving and environmentally friendly. Its softness and fatigue resistance can meet the more complex pipeline design of floor heating.

HVAC system

In the HVAC system, PERT pipe is used to transport hot and cold water, which can ensure the operation of the pipeline system, avoid heat loss, and reduce energy consumption.

Water supply system

PERT pipe is used to transport drinking water and industrial water in the water supply system. Its health, environmental protection, high flow, and low toxicity can meet the requirements of safety, hygiene, and high efficiency.

Industrial pipeline

In the industrial field, PERT pipe is used to transport chemical media, water supply, oil products, etc. Its corrosion resistance and high-temperature performance ensure the smooth and safe operation of industrial production.

Urban thermal transformation

PERT pipe has been widely used in urban thermal transformation. It has good high and low temperature resistance and is suitable for secondary pipe network transformation of heating system.

 

 
Process of PERT Pipe
 
01/

Preparation raw materials
•Main raw materials: PERT resin.

•Additives: In order to improve the performance of the pipe, some additives are usually added, such as antioxidants, stabilizers, colorants, etc.

02/

Extrusion
•Add the prepared raw materials to the extruder and extrude them through the extruder. (Extrusion temperature that is too high or too low will affect the performance of the pipe and needs to be strictly controlled)

03/

Vacuum shaping and cooling
•After mold molding, a pipe blank is formed. After spraying or immersion cooling, it is quickly cooled and shaped.

04/

Winding or cutting
•Winding: Roll qualified pipes into a certain length of pipe rolls for easy transportation and storage.

•Cutting: Cut the pipe rolls into the required length according to customer needs.

05/

Inspection
•During the production process, the size, thickness, appearance, etc. of the pipe are inspected online to ensure product quality.

06/

Marking and packing:
•The final stage of the process is marking the pipes with relevant information such as size and pressure ratings. They are then packed in bundles and stored in warehouses awaiting distribution to different sites.

 

PERT Pipe Step-by-Step Installation Guide

 

 
 

Planning and Preparation

Begin by mapping out your plumbing system. Identify areas where PERT pipes will run and position fittings, connectors, and any necessary valves. Measure and mark the required pipe lengths using the measuring tape.

 
 

Cutting and Deburring

Use a pipe cutter to cut the PERT pipes to the measured lengths. Ensure the cuts are straight and clean. After cutting, use a deburring tool to smooth the edges of the pipe ends, removing any burrs that may cause leaks or blockages.

 
 

Assembling the Pipes

Insert fittings and connectors into the pipe ends. Ensure they are compatible with PERT pipes to create secure and leak-free joints. Use wrenches to tighten the fittings as per the manufacturer’s recommendations.

 
 

Securing the Pipes

Attach clips or brackets at regular intervals along the pipes to prevent sagging. Ensure the pipes are firmly positioned and supported, reducing stress on joints and connections.

 
 

Connecting to Fixtures

Connect the assembled PERT pipes to the plumbing fixtures or appliances. Double-check all connections to ensure they are tight and properly sealed.

 
 

Pressure Testing

Use a pressure testing kit to check for leaks. Gradually pressurize the system to the recommended operating pressure and monitor for any drops in pressure. Address any leaks immediately by tightening or reassembling the affected joints.

 
 

Insulating (if required)

If additional thermal protection is needed, wrap the pipes with insulation tape, particularly in areas susceptible to temperature fluctuations.

 
 

Final Check

Once everything is installed and tested, conduct a final check of the entire system. Ensure all connections are secure, the pipes are properly supported, and there are no visible leaks or defects.

Q: What is PERT pipe?

A: PERT pipe, or Polyethylene of Raised Temperature Resistance pipe, is a type of high-temperature flexible plastic pressure pipe. It is commonly used in applications such as potable water systems, underfloor heating, and geothermal piping systems.

Q: How does PERT pipe compare to HDPE?

A: PERT pipe provides superior long-term hydrostatic strength compared to HDPE. It is designed to maintain its strength at high temperatures, making it suitable for applications that require long-term hydrostatic strength at high temperatures.

Q: Can PERT pipe be used for underfloor heating?

A: Yes, PERT pipe is commonly used for underfloor heating due to its flexibility and ability to withstand high temperatures. It is designed to provide efficient and reliable heating for residential and commercial properties.

Q: What are the maintenance requirements for PERT pipes?

A: PERT pipes require minimal maintenance due to their durability and resistance to corrosion and scaling. However, regular inspection and cleaning may be necessary to ensure optimal performance and prolong the lifespan of the system.

Q: What is the lifespan of PERT pipes?

A: The lifespan of PERT pipes can vary depending on the specific application and the installation method. However, they are known for their durability and can last for many years with proper installation and maintenance.

Q: What is the difference between PERT and PEX?

A: PERT pipes are more flexible than PEX pipes, which makes them easier to install. They are also less prone to kinking, which can cause water flow restrictions and result in reduced water pressure. This makes PERT pipes ideal for use in areas where tight turns or bends are required.
